Summary:
Xcode's built-in support for version-control should support Mercurial as well as Subversion and other VCSs.

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open a project.
2. Get Info on the project object.
3. Click “Configure Roots & SCM…”.
4. Attempt to select Mercurial as the SCM system (VCS) for the project.

Expected Results:
I successfully select Mercurial as the VCS for the project.

Actual Results:
Mercurial is not listed.

Regression:
None. Xcode has never supported Mercurial.
